FA Cup Quarter Final match at Upton Park. West Ham 1 v Aston Villa 0

FA Cup Quarter Final match at Upton Park.
West Ham 1 v Aston Villa 0.
West Ham players celebrate after Ray Stewart scored the games only goal from the penalty spot to send Villa crashing out of the cup.
8th March 1980

FA Cup Quarter Final match at Upton Park. West Ham 1 v Aston Villa 0. In this print captured by David Graves, we are transported back to the thrilling FA Cup Quarter Final match at Upton Park on the 8th of March, 1980. The intense action and electric atmosphere are palpable as West Ham United triumphed over Aston Villa with a score of 1-0. The image showcases a moment of pure jubilation as West Ham players erupt in celebration after Ray Stewart successfully converted a penalty kick, securing their victory and sending Aston Villa crashing out of the cup.
